Step inside the intimate Prince of Wales and you enter a world you wont find anywhere else.Located in the heart of historic Niagara-on-the-Lake the Prince of Wales is an oasis of Victorian elegance filled with 21st century comforts. The hotel was named in honour of a royal visit in 1901 when the future George V stayed here. Today every guest experiences the sophistication and refinement of that bygone age.Our Secret Garden Spa is an oasis of serenity in a setting unlike any other. Immerse yourself in this secret world and pamper yourself with treatments that include state-of-the-art hydrotherapy healing reflexology and the ancient art of aromatherapy.Escab che the hotels restaurant features a dynamic menu in which familiar foods are prepared in innovative style. Our Sommelier Fred Gamula guides you through our collection of wine thoughtfully selected from the most prestigious vineyards in the Niagara Region and around the world. Or if you prefer a less formal dinner stop by Churchill Lounge.The tradition of afternoon high tea is honoured daily from noon to 6pm in our beloved Drawing Room. Sip exotic loose leaf teas from around the globe and nibble on delicate finger sandwiches and fine pastries amidst stunning decor reminiscent of the Victorian era.Our concierge team members of the exclusive Les Clefs d Or association are highly skilled professionals who are passionate about providing exceptional personal service to our guests.Reserve your room at the Prince of Wales today and begin a beautiful friendship.

Watch the parking!

Parking area is part hotel and part metered, with poor signage to distinguish. We ended up getting a ticket AND being charged parking by the hotel - a bit much (and no apologies). Pool area was so overheated as to be unusable.

Truly lovely hotel

The Prince of Wales is simply lovely. Gorgeous inside (our wooden four poster bed was stunning, the bathroom was well appointed), above and beyond customer service (truly, we've never had such over the top customer service - these folks are at the top of their game), fantastic food in Escabeche, their restaurant (still dreaming about the Eggs Benedict), and literally at the center of the charming town.

Gorgeous hotel

Absolutely gorgeous, fully restored hotel. Room was a little small for the king size bed, bathroom was fabulous. Very, very clean. We were able to enjoy the pools at the other 2 properties owned by the same hotel company.
